# Service Accounts: Bouncebird

Bouncebird, our email bounce processor, runs under the `svc-bouncebird` account and polls the Mailvale queue every two minutes. If a release touches the queue schema, bump the consumer version first or bounces pile up fast. The account authenticates to the internal Quillgate API with a key we rotate each release cycle. The current key, good until next cutover, is:

API key for yahig-tadup: kto7_ubizbYm

**TICKET-88: Snacktrak vault locked itself again**

The secrets vault for the Snacktrak restock planner sealed after the Tuesday power blip, and nobody on shift had unseal rights. For future maintainers: don't panic, this happens roughly quarterly. Re-run the unseal script from the ops box, then enter the passphrase that follows below.

unlock words, yawig-kagef: gordor-holvan-ulaael-pramir-ulaiel-tamdor

Autocomplete queries on Pinwheel Search have been timing out since Monday. Root cause: the Lexifor index-sync worker's credentials expired last week, so the suggestion index is stale and falling back to full scans. Rotation is done; reviewer should confirm the worker config references the new value, which follows below.

gateway credential: kto3_qfe